- The distance between Moca, Dominican Republic and Copenhagen, Denmark is approximately 7,808 km or 4,852 mi.
- To reach Moca in this distance one would set out from Copenhagen bearing 275.7° or W and follow the great circles arc to approach Moca bearing 216.5° or SW .
- Moca has a tropical rainforest climate (Af) whereas Copenhagen has a marine west coast climate (Cfb).
- Moca is in or near the subtropical moist forest biome whereas Copenhagen is in or near the cool temperate moist forest biome.
- The average annual temperature is 16.3 °C (29.3°F) warmer.
- Average monthly temperatures vary by 14.6 °C (26.3°F) less in Moca. The continentality subtype is truly hyperoceanic as opposed to semicontinental.
- Total annual precipitation averages 631.3 mm (24.9 in) more which is equivalent to 631.3 l/m² (15.49 US gal/ft²) or 6,313,000 l/ha (674,902 US gal/ac) more. About 2 as much.
- The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 35.1° higher in Moca than in Copenhagen.
